The Center for Cancer & Blood Disorders



Current Clinical Trials as of July 18, 2011

We welcome your participation in a clinical trial for cancer research. If you would like more information on the clinical trials listed below, please call Joyce Wallace, Research Manager, at 817.759.7022 or send an email to jwallace@txcc.com.

Diagnosis Study Name Brief Study Description
Triple Negative Breast BRE 01-08 Neoadjuvant weekly nab-paclitaxel (Abraxane) plus Carboplatin followed by Doxorubicin plus Cyclophosphamide with Bevacizumab added concurrently to chemo for palpable and operable triple negative breast cancer
Metastatic Breast BRE 161 Amrubicin as 2nd or 3rd Line Treatment for Patients with HER2 Negative Metastatic Breast Cancer
Colorectal GI 134 FOLFOXIRI plus Panitumumab as 1st Line Therapy for KRAS Wild-type Patients with Metastatic Colorectal Cancer with Liver Metastases Only
Diffuse Large B-cell Lymphoma Novartis – RAD001N2301 Randomized, CHOP-R +/- RAD 001
Peripheral T-Cell Lymphoma COMPLETE Registry Primary objective is to describe, in detail, patterns of care for patients with peripheral T-cell lymphoma, by treatment setting.
Multiple Myeloma Novartis CLBH589D2308 Randomized, double-blind, placebo controlled phase III study of panobinostat in combination with bortezomib and dexamethasone in patients with relapsed multiple myeloma

1st Line NSCLC Lilly H3E-US-S130 Randomized, Open-Label study of Pemetrexed + Carboplatin in patients w/ Nonsquamous Histology

Stage IV NSCLC Lilly I4T-MC-JVBA Randomized, double-blind, phase III study of Docetaxel and Ramucirumab vs. Docetaxel and placebo in the treatment of stage IV NSCLC following disease progression after one prior platinum-based therapy
Ovarian GYN 19 Randomized Study of Paclitaxel/Carboplatin with or without Sorafenib in the 1st Line Treatment of Patients with Stage III/IV Epithelial Ovarian Cancer
Prostate BMS- CA184043 Randomized, Double Blinded, Ipilimumab vs. Placebo post Radiotherapy
Unknown Primary UNKPRI 20 Chemotherapy Based on Molecular Profiling Diagnosis for Patients with Carcinoma of Unknown Primary Site
